Project

General

Profile

Actions

Task #46358

closed

Separate ext:statictemplates code from core

Added by Christian Kuhn about 11 years ago. Updated over 5 years ago.

Status:
Closed
Priority:
Should have
Assignee:
-
Category:
-
Target version:
-
Start date:
2013-03-16
Due date:
% Done:

100%

Estimated time:
TYPO3 Version:
6.1
PHP Version:
5.3
Tags:
Complexity:
medium
Sprint Focus:

Description

The three menu types GMENU_LAYERS GMENU_FOLDOUT and TMENU_LAYERS use
javascript files of statictemplates and belong to the extensions.
Using the new factory of issue #46292, those three menu objects are
now transferred to statictemplates extension.

For upgrade to TYPO3 CMS 4.5 an ugrade wizard was created to install
statictemplates system extension if the database tables was in use.
Everything before 4.5 is out of support for a long time, so we can
expect the extension to be already loaded if it is used. The old
upgrade wizard is removed now.

Some statictemplates specific code in ext:tstemplate is substituted
with hooks, used by statictemplates.


Related issues 16 (0 open16 closed)

Related to TYPO3 Core - Bug #46292: HMENU rendering uses old tslib_ class namesClosed2013-03-14

Actions
Related to TYPO3 Core - Feature #39020: tmenu_layers.php / gmenu_layers.php: remove hardcoded cssRejected2012-07-17

Actions
Related to TYPO3 Core - Bug #28640: TMENU_LAYERS does not always create unique IDs for the third levelRejected2011-08-01

Actions
Related to TYPO3 Core - Bug #21388: typo3temp got filled with thousands of javascript_* filesRejected2009-10-28

Actions
Related to TYPO3 Core - Bug #23866: layered menus generate "too much recursion javascript-error"Rejected2010-10-28

Actions
Related to TYPO3 Core - Feature #17644: class property for GMENU_LAYERSRejected2007-10-02

Actions
Related to TYPO3 Core - Bug #16944: GMenu and TMenu: Rendering "borderswithin" doesn't work with Firefox and Doctype HTML 4.01 TransitionalRejectedOliver Hader2007-07-26

Actions
Related to TYPO3 Core - Bug #16669: GMENU_LAYERS: Menu items without Submenus are not reset after RORejected2006-10-25

Actions
Related to TYPO3 Core - Feature #16249: GMENU_LAYERS: 4 features / patch suggestionsRejected2006-06-16

Actions
Related to TYPO3 Core - Feature #15889: Clean up inline javascript in menu_layers.phpRejected2006-03-23

Actions
Related to TYPO3 Core - Feature #17035: Approach and patch for removing all inline JavaScriptRejected2007-02-24

Actions
Related to TYPO3 Core - Bug #24402: too much recursion in jsfunc.layermenu.js in FF / out of memory in IERejected2010-12-23

Actions
Related to TYPO3 Core - Bug #22315: Bug in TMENU_LAYERS in Firefox 3.6Rejected2010-03-23

Actions
Related to TYPO3 Core - Bug #20874: GMENU_FOLDOUT does not render the onclick event (and becomes useless)Rejected2009-08-13

Actions
Related to TYPO3 Core - Bug #19909: Menu_layers obstructs links below menu layers when hidden - IE onlyRejected2009-01-25

Actions
Follows TYPO3 Core - Feature #18194: Remove Static Templates from Standard InstallationClosedBenni Mack2008-02-12

Actions
Actions #1

Updated by Gerrit Code Review about 11 years ago

  • Status changed from New to Under Review

Patch set 1 for branch master has been pushed to the review server.
It is available at https://review.typo3.org/18974

Actions #2

Updated by Gerrit Code Review about 11 years ago

Patch set 2 for branch master has been pushed to the review server.
It is available at https://review.typo3.org/18974

Actions #3

Updated by Gerrit Code Review about 11 years ago

Patch set 3 for branch master has been pushed to the review server.
It is available at https://review.typo3.org/18974

Actions #4

Updated by Gerrit Code Review about 11 years ago

Patch set 4 for branch master has been pushed to the review server.
It is available at https://review.typo3.org/18974

Actions #5

Updated by Christian Kuhn about 11 years ago

  • Status changed from Under Review to Resolved
  • % Done changed from 0 to 100
Actions #6

Updated by Benni Mack over 5 years ago

  • Status changed from Resolved to Closed
Actions

Also available in: Atom PDF